Ongoing popular music reality TV show, Zain/MTV Advance Warning will take a new, exciting turn this weekend as the programme promises viewers an amazing television experience, profiling the life, times and rhymes of two upcoming Nigerian Hip Hop stars, Kel and Terry G.
According to the organizers of the show, Zain Nigeria and MTV, the fifth episode of the high profile musical programme will feature biographies and lifestyles of the participating artistes’ as well as capture the fascinating and hilarious musical moments of the Hip hop duo.

Zain Nigeria’s Chief Marketing Officer, Norman Moyo, said the presence of emerging stars like Kel and Terry G in the Zain/MTV Advance Warning contest is an indication of the vast talent pool in the country, adding that the young adults oriented music programme is designed to open vista of opportunity for Nigeria rising music stars to become superstars.
He said the mobile company has to provide the aspiring stars the needed ladder to stardom, urging the contestants and their fans to take advantage of the opportunity provided by Zain and MTV.
Already, fans of Satellite Town’s rap act, Kel believes that the 22 year old Capital Hill Records signing has what it takes to rock the microphone, suggesting that she is capable of producing the right lyrical content, rhythmic punch-lines, attitude and finesse to make life difficult for her co-contestant, Terry G.
Kel will release her debut album later in the year. Industry sources claim that the expected musical work will feature collaborations with several African acts such as Durela, Illbliss, Nyore and Jabba from South African hip-hop group, Hip-hop Pantsula (HHP). The album will also feature songs produced by Dr. Frabs, Knighthouse, J. Martins and Tha Suspect.
In an on-line interview, Kel hinted that the first single of her expected compilation is Waa wa alright!, adding that the song was produced by Tha Suspect (another Capital Hill artiste) and features verses from Skin, an upcoming hip hop artiste.
Interestingly, some Nigerian music critics have tipped Terry G as a strong force to reckon with, hinting that the R’n’B singer has what it takes to emerge winner of Zain/MTV Advance Warning. The winning prize this year is a whooping N5 million, an opportunity for the winner to get his music video produced by a top international music video director and guaranteed airplay by MTV Base.
Aside performances, Terry G has produced banging beats for several music acts. His first step towards production limelight was in 2006 when he featured and produced Shake Dat for Nigeria’s Rythm 93.7’s music presenter, Kemistry. Terry G is signed to Bluemoon Entertainment.
A total of 26 artistes will feature on the Zain/MTV Advance Warning show. So far, the entertainment programme has featured four pairs of Nigerian artistes namely: Durella vs O.D; W4 vs G. I Joe, Terry Da Rapman vs Soty and Pype vs Waje. Other artistes yet to take their turns include GT the Guitarman, M.I., SLK, Soty, Blaise, Big Weez, Amaka, Zdon, Kani, Kaha, Frank D’Nero, D La La, Kenzos, Nikki Laoye, F. Shaw, Barbara and Cyrus The Virus.
Zain/MTV Advance Warning airs every Sunday between 7.30 and 8.00pm on MTV Base Channel (DStv Channel 322) and between 6.00 and 6.30pm on Nigeria terrestrial TV Stations: Silverbird Television (STV) and African Independent Television (AIT).
Music lovers can participate in the show by voting for their favourite artistes every week via SMS. To vote, viewers need to send SMS containing their choice artiste to 33970.
